BusinessWeek Europe is reporting about the rapid shift in real estate broker advertising from newspapers to the net. “Three new studies say the $11.6 billion real estate ad market is set to shift hard from print to the Internet.” Find out more about how this move to internet advertising will affect the newspaper business.
